Output d1b70ffbf003aa7013fbd441a9a991ebb0194f937adca424b2d54fc0a7f60862:0

value
22237874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c756ecf35b277789fe3492017cfa08e6207fbaf OP_EQUAL
address
3QhttGB4xqwgP3CzTFGnDU3CUSgEGBexQd
transaction
d1b70ffbf003aa7013fbd441a9a991ebb0194f937adca424b2d54fc0a7f60862
confirmations
432481
spent
true